Soak in the sights of Bali’s 1000 year-old, cliffside temple - Uluwatu! We make the most of the morning exploring before heading for a language lesson to set you up for the trip. Then some quality beach time on one of Bali's most scenic beaches. Sunset beer me, please!
Bali is a world-renowned paradise for surfers. The sandy bottoms and slow-moving surf of Kuta make it the ideal place for your surfing lesson. Then, to Tanah Lot Temple for sunset. This is one of Bali's famous Seven Sea Hindu Temples - with all seven constructed within eyesight to the next to form a chain that is believed to protect the coast from invaders. Then to Canggu - one of Bali's most laid-back beach towns.

Then we head to Air Tegungan Waterfalls to swim and explore this jaw-dropping spectacle. Finish with a visit to the 9th-century temple of Goa Gajah - also known as Elephant Cave. This is a UNESCO World Heritage Site that was not fully unearthed until the 1950s.

Hidden away in the jungle is the jaw-dropping Sekumpul Waterfalls! Widely regarded as "the most beautiful waterfall in Bali", we spend the morning trekking, swimming, and exploring the basin of several rivers that feed the waterfalls streaming down from above - one waterfall from up to 80 metres high.
